1. When did you start playing ET, and how did you get into it?
    Was introduced to ET around 2006 by my older brother, we played it during our studying breaks.

  2. What's your most memorable moment so far in your ET history, and why?
    CPC2 lan where I made my first big ET attendance after being accused of being a cheater online. All the big 2008 names where sitting behind me and it made me so nervous I almost shit myself. Cherry on top is that we won that lan and I took the MVP award.

  3. What do you feel is the most important skill in terms of contributing to winning in ET?
    In 2023 it is putting your ego aside and help the team where it lacks. Damage & kills mostly depend on the position you get on each stage and map, people seem to forget that.
